San Miguel de Allende, a charming colonial town nestled in the heart of Mexico, is a vibrant destination that offers a unique blend of history, culture, and natural beauty. As a tourist, you may be wondering how to immerse yourself in the lively spirit of this magical place. Here are three things that you can do to experience the vibrant feeling of San Miguel de Allende:
1. Stroll through the colorful streets: One of the best ways to soak in the atmosphere of San Miguel de Allende is by wandering around its cobblestone streets, adorned with brightly colored houses and whimsical wrought-iron balconies. As you meander, you'll come across an array of art galleries, studios, and shops, each offering a unique glimpse into the town's rich artistic heritage. Don't forget to look up and admire the stunning architecture, which reflects the town's storied past and its significance as a UNESCO World Heritage Site.
2. Savor the local cuisine: San Miguel de Allende is a food lover's paradise, offering a diverse range of dishes that reflect its Mexican heritage and international influences. From street food vendors and cozy cafes to fine dining restaurants, there's no shortage of options for satisfying your culinary curiosities. Be sure to try traditional Mexican dishes, such as enchiladas, chiles rellenos, and tamales, as well as local specialties like carnitas and pulque. And, if you have a sweet tooth, indulge in some delicious pastries and confections at one of the many panaderías around town.
3. Experience the nightlife: San Miguel de Allende truly comes alive after dark, with an array of entertainment options that cater to all tastes and preferences. Whether you're looking to enjoy live music, dance the night away, or simply enjoy a cocktail with friends, you'll find plenty of opportunities to experience the town's vibrant energy. Visit local bars and clubs, such as La Cucaracha, El Grito, or The Monkey Bar, or attend one of the many cultural events, such as concerts, theatrical performances, and art exhibitions, held at various venues around town.
By exploring the colorful streets, savoring the local cuisine, and experiencing the nightlife, you'll be able to fully immerse yourself in the authentic and vibrant spirit of San Miguel de Allende. Mexico Independence Day, known as Día de la Independencia, is a nationwide celebration that offers a wealth of cultural experiences for visitors. While you can find lively festivities across the country, San Miguel de Allende stands out as one of the best places to witness this colorful spectacle. The central plaza, or El Jardin, comes alive with the energy of the locals and the curiosity of tourists, all eager to partake in the day's events.
